Stepping into the Realm of the Nightreign Nightlord:

In an impressive display of skill, a dedicated Elden Ring player, going by the name Ongbal on YouTube, recently tackled the Nightreign final boss utilizing a build reminiscent of their favorite FromSoftware game - Sekiro.

As our friends at PCGamer pointed out, Ongbal deploys the Executor class for the showdown, a choice that aligns well with Sekiro's gameplay due to the Executor's katana weapon and the ability to parry strikes like the cursed shinobi from Sekiro. The result is a mesmerizing performance of deflected blows.

Though Nightreign is designed for trios, it can be tackled solo if you prefer playing without random players. Bandai Namco suggests teaming up for the challenge, so if you're venturing solo, make sure you've honed your skills to a sharp edge.

Taking on the Nightreign final boss, Heolstor, Ongbal fights an imposing foe that evokes memories of Artorias with its hunched posture, heavy sword, and lumbering strikes. However, once conquering that first health bar, Heolstor's true strength reveals itself. It becomes quicker, dishes out more area-of-effect damage, and forces players to use health flasks.

The most exhilarating moment in the fight comes when Heolstor plunges towards half health, slashing open time and space itself, invoking another reality. Ongbal is put under pressure, but their unwavering determination pays off as they slay the Nightlord solo, armed solely with their katana.
